They are some of the most impactful cards I've ever picked up. Quite literally my build would just be Dwarf + Giant if I wanted to min-max. The stat differences they give are huge.
Even just 1 dwarf takes any setup from good to busted. The difference in mobility is absurd.
It's a moon grav and like 2 speedsters combined, and also makes your hitbox smaller.
Compared to literally any other legendary character mod it's godlike. I'd run it over glass cannon literally any day.
Not even talking about firerate.
Giant is maybe slightly less powerful but it gives spell cooldown reduction on top of making you tankier and giving you overall damage.
Both of them are absurd, and if you don't realize that they are then I don't think you've had much experience with them.

Better way to test it is to repeatedly run far far north- it has a guarenteed legendary on the train. All you'd need to do is have five empty card slots to emulate having it in your base build.
To have a good baseline, just do that map without grabbing the legendary with a normal set up. (I did this, by the way. I got only 10-5% more damage from giant.)
Sure, but you're only measuring damage. It also grants spell CDR and increases health, with the only ""downside"" being that you're larger, which I feel is actually good since it gives you a higher sightline and makes it possible to pick out prime targets from a crowd since you can see over the crowd.
